#1e3b2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e3b2c is composed of 11.8% red, 23.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 149 degrees, a saturation of 32.6% and a lightness of 17.5%. #1e3b2c color hex could be obtained by blending #3c7658 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#1e3b2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e3b2c has RGB values of R:30, G:59,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 1981228.
